Level 1 Inspection
A Level 1 inspection is the standard check that comes with every sweep in Poquoson. We examine the flue interior, damper function, chimney cap condition, and the accessible exterior masonry and flashing from the roof or ground. In this climate, the damper and cap get extra attention. Salt corrosion seizes them faster than most homeowners expect.

Creosote Removal
First-degree creosote is a brush job. Third-degree is a glaze. Poquoson homeowners burning wood regularly through fall and winter build up creosote faster in humid conditions because moisture condenses inside the flue and binds the deposits. We remove it thoroughly with the right brushes and, when needed, mechanical rotary tools on heavier glaze. The goal is a clean, clear path for smoke and draft.

Soot Removal
Soot removal matters even in a home that only burns occasional fires. Fine soot coats the flue and damper components, and in Poquoson’s damp air it can form a pasty layer that clings to metal and accelerates corrosion. We clean it out, then check that the damper still operates smoothly and the flue still pulls an honest draft.

Annual Sweep
Once a year, burn or no burn. Chimneys break in the off-season too. Salt air, summer humidity, and the occasional tropical system do their damage while the fireplace sits idle. An annual sweep in Poquoson includes the level of cleaning your flue actually needs, a damper and cap check, and a plain-English verdict on anything that needs watching.

Common Chimney Cleaning & Sweep Problems We See in Poquoson Homes
- Salt crystalline deposits inside the flue. After nor’easters and tropical systems, salt-laden spray works its way into chimneys and leaves white crystalline residue on flue walls. Homeowners notice a draft blockage or smoke backing up and assume it’s normal creosote. It’s a storm signature, and it needs to come out.
- Corroded and seized dampers. The combination of salt air and humidity causes dampers to corrode and stick. We see this constantly in 1960s and 1970s ranch homes across Poquoson, where original dampers were never designed for a marine environment.
- Water intrusion from failed flashing and cracked crowns. Poquoson’s wind-driven rain finds every gap. Failed flashing around the chimney chase shows up as a ceiling stain inside the house, sometimes months after the storm that caused it.
- Hidden moisture damage from past storm surge. Hurricane Isabel put water into fireboxes and lower flue structures across this city. Homeowners in Poquoson who never connected the floodwater to their chimney still deal with spalling bricks and damaged firebox mortar years later.
Pricing for Chimney Cleaning & Sweep in Poquoson, VA
A standard chimney cleaning with a Level 1 inspection in Poquoson runs $189 to $285. If the flue has heavy third-degree creosote glaze or years of salt residue buildup, expect $300 to $400 for the extra mechanical work. A separate Level 2 inspection, which includes camera work and the full interior and exterior review, runs $249 to $399 depending on chimney height and access. Damper replacement in Poquoson typically runs $180 to $350 for a Famco damper installed, and chimney cap replacement runs $95 to $250. It is not reliably safe to use your fireplace after a Poquoson nor’easter without at least a quick professional look. Storm wind and salt spray can dislodge a chimney cap, deposit salt residue inside the flue, or drive water into the damper assembly. Firing the fireplace before checking can push a hidden blockage into a chimney fire risk. A sweep or Level 1 inspection costs $189 to $285, and it answers the question before you strike a match. You can tell your chimney flashing failed during a Poquoson storm if a brown or yellow stain appears on the ceiling or wall around the chimney chase, often appearing days to weeks after heavy rain. Outside, look for pulled-back flashing edges, cracked sealant, or gaps where the chimney meets the roofline. Wind-driven rain off the Poquoson River and Back River finds these openings fast.
